Output e613e08ba0dc3124ca7bed6ef892fac9e18ded7021de66f8089e547fb451a5bf:1

value
27398350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17372462f5927872fa5d2ae23de991066c6d9a56 OP_EQUAL
address
33omXJGcWiNytCM7EdWLinSZN1diexzuDS
transaction
e613e08ba0dc3124ca7bed6ef892fac9e18ded7021de66f8089e547fb451a5bf
confirmations
497067
spent
true